Overview
ZVP0545G from Diodes Incorporated is a P-channel enhancement-mode vertical DMOS FET in SOT223 package, rated for -450 V drain-source voltage and 150 Ω RDS(ON) at VGS = -10 V, delivering -75 mA continuous drain current at +25°C - used in high-voltage power management circuits such as offline AC-DC auxiliary supplies and LED driver bias rails.
For engineers reviewing the ZVP0545G datasheet, ZVP0545G pinout, ZVP0545G application, or ZVP0545G equivalent, key selection criteria include verified high-voltage blocking capability (-450 V), low-leakage off-state performance (IDSS ≤ -2 µA at -360 V), thermal stability across -55°C to +150°C, and SOT223 package compatibility with board-level thermal management in space-constrained industrial power stages.
Technical Context
This MOSFET employs vertical DMOS architecture optimized for high-voltage, low-current switching with gate threshold voltage ranging from -1.5 V to -4.5 V and normalized RDS(ON) variation under junction temperature stress (±20% from -55°C to +150°C). Its transconductance of 40 mS at VDS = -25 V supports stable gain in linear-regulator or current-sense configurations.
Dynamic parameters include Ciss = 120 pF, Coss = 20 pF, and Crss = 5 pF at VDS = -25 V, enabling predictable turn-on/turn-off timing (tD(ON) ≤ 10 ns, tF ≤ 20 ns) in low-power, high-side switch applications where gate drive energy and EMI control are critical.

FAQ
Is ZVP0545G recommended for new designs?
No - Diodes Incorporated explicitly states "ZVP0545G IS NOT RECOMMENDED FOR NEW DESIGNS" in the datasheet. It remains available for existing production and legacy support, but engineers should consult Diodes for qualified replacements like the ZVP4525G or AP2311WNG for new projects requiring similar high-voltage P-channel functionality.
What is the maximum safe operating temperature for ZVP0545G?
ZVP0545G has a specified junction temperature range of -55°C to +150°C. Its absolute maximum power dissipation is 2 W at +25°C ambient, derating linearly to zero at +150°C case temperature. Thermal design must ensure junction temperature stays within this limit using appropriate copper area and thermal vias under the exposed drain pad.
Can ZVP0545G be used in linear (analog) mode?
Yes - its SOA curve (Figure 12) confirms safe operation in linear mode for short pulses (e.g., PW ≤ 10 ms at VDS = -25 V, ID = -75 mA), and its gate threshold spread (-1.5 V to -4.5 V) allows predictable turn-on behavior in analog current regulation. However, sustained linear operation requires careful thermal management due to RDS(ON) temperature coefficient.
Does ZVP0545G have integrated ESD protection?
No - the datasheet does not specify on-chip ESD protection diodes. Gate-source leakage (IGSS ≤ 20 nA) and absence of HBM/CDM ratings indicate external protection (e.g., series gate resistor + TVS) is required in handling and circuit layout to prevent damage from electrostatic discharge during assembly or field operation.
